UML calls secretariat meeting to discuss six ordinances



KATHMANDU: The UML has scheduled a secretariat meeting for next Sunday at its central office in Chyasal.

According to a UML secretariat member, the meeting will focus on the six ordinances introduced by the government, as well as contemporary political and internal party matters.

“The six ordinances will also be discussed. The party’s opinion on how to proceed will be formed,” the member said.
